2 Experimental Section CAUTIN Azides can be very explosive compounds and should be handled with great care. During our study we encountered no problems. All chemicals were purchased and used without any further purification. In this work we have used de-ionized water. Ion exchange was performed on Dowex 50WX8-400 and eluted with a 1M NH 4 H aqueous solution prepared using bi-distilled water. rganic solvents were dried by conventional methods, GC analyses were performed with an SPB-5 fused silica capillary column (30 m, 0.25 mm diameter), an on column injector system, a FID detector and hydrogen as the carrier gas. GC-MS analyses were carried out with 70 ev electron energy. Amino acids were analyzed as trimethylslyl derivatives that were prepared following procedures. [1] The β-azido-αhydroxycarboxylic acids were analyzed by GC as methyl ester derivatives obtained by treating them with an ether solution of CH 2 N 2. All 1 H NMR spectra were taken on a 400 spectrometer in D 2 with 1,4-dioxane at 3.75 ppm. All 13 C NMR spectra were taken at MHz in D 2 with 1,4-dioxane at ppm. Chiral HPLC analyses were performed by using a CHIRALCEL D-H column (250 x 46 mm, 5 µm) and an UV detector set at 250 nm. All melting points are uncorrected. The α-hydroxy-β-amino acids 4, 5, 9a-9c and 9f are known in the literature. [2] 3, 9d, 9e and 9g are new compounds and are described below. Wt.: Method: 10.0 mmol (1.300 g) of a (+)-(2S,3R)-2,3-epoxyhexanoic acid (6) were dissolved in water (10 ml). Powdered NaN 3 (0.975 g, 15 mmol) and 10 ml of an aqueous solution 0.1 M of Cu(N 3 ) 2 were added under stirring (resulting ph ~ 4.3) and warmed to 65 C. After 1.5 h (ph ~ 5.5) the reaction mixture was cooled to 0 C, and NaBH 4 was added portion-wise (0.757 g, 20 mmol). After 30 min the reaction mixture was filtered and the copper boride was separated quantitatively. The aqueous mother liquors were acidified to red (indicator paper) with a few drops of concentrated HCl and charged on an ion-exchange resin Dowex 50WX Eluting with NH 4 H 0.1 M the title compound 3 was isolated after aqueous phase evaporation, in 83 % yield as a white crystalline solid.
